Pizza Potato Skins

9 ingredients
13 steps

Ingredients

  • 8 whole Small Russet Potatoes
  • Canola Oil
  • Butter, Melted
  • Kosher Salt
  • Jarred Marinara Or Pizza Sauce
  • Grated Mozzarella Cheese
  • Diced Pepperoni
  • Minced Fresh Parsley
  • Miscellaneous Pizza Toppings: Cooked Sausage, Cooked Hamburger, Diced Bell Pepper, Diced Onion, Diced Mushrooms, Diced Canadian Bacon, Etc.

Directions

  1. 1
    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.
  2. 2
    Scrub potatoes very clean.
  3. 3
    Rub the surface of each potato with canola oil.
  4. 4
    Sprinkle with salt and bake until the potatoes are tender and the skins are crisp, about 30 to 45 minutes.
  5. 5
    Cut the baked potatoes in half, then use a spoon to scoop out most of the insides, leaving a bit of a rim all around.
  6. 6
    Brush the inside and outside of each half with melted butter.
  7. 7
    Place the potatoes skin side up and return to the oven for 5 to 7 minutes.
  8. 8
    Turn them over (using tongs) and put them back in the oven for a few more minutes, or until the potatoes are crisp.
  9. 9
    Remove them from the oven and set them aside.
  10. 10
    To assemble the skins, fill each skin with a spoonful of marinara or pizza sauce.
  11. 11
    Add a good amount of grated cheese and sprinkle on some diced pepperoni.
  12. 12
    Return them to the oven for just a couple of minutes, or until the cheese is melted.
  13. 13
    Sprinkle with minced parsley and serve immediately!
